SC hearing writ against cabinet reformation today



KATHMANDU: The Supreme Court (SC) is hearing the writ petition filed against the cabinet reformation on Thursday.

A single bench of Justice Ishwor Prasad Khatiwada is scheduled to hear the writ petition, according to a source at the SC.

Senor advocates Dinesh Tripathi and Lokendra Oli had filed the case against the cabinet reformation arguing that the Oli-led caretaker government cannot reform the cabinet.
